Is Aloha POS a trustworthy vendor?
- 2011-07-22NCR acquired Radiant Systems (Aloha owner) for $1.2B
- 2023-10-22NCR spun off Voyix (NYSE:VYX); Aloha under Voyix
- 2024-09-22Customer reports of slow innovation pace; Toast and SpotOn winning new chain accounts

Editorial: Strengths
- Largest chain-restaurant installed base
- Deep multi-location franchise reporting
- Mature enterprise inventory and labor features
- Public NCR Voyix parent stability
- Strong fit for existing Aloha installations
Editorial: Weaknesses
- Innovation pace slow relative to Toast and SpotOn
- UX dated
- Post-NCR Voyix spin-off product velocity mixed
- Modern challengers winning new chain accounts
- Support quality varies by reseller
